(A) The driver of a vehicle shall not follow another more closely than is reasonable and prudent, having due regard to the speed of such vehicle and the traffic upon and condition of the roadway. On busy I-80 through Placer County, traffic flow You can get a ticket for "following too closely" for tailgating. The law does not specify a certain number of feet for following distance, but rather focuses on what is 'reasonable and prudent' under the circumstances. Officers may issue citations when they see a driver failing to adjust their distance in response to sudden braking or congestion.
